On Wed, May 31, 2006, Ade Bamigboye wrote:
> To fully make use of the BlueZ stack, an application needs to run as 
> root on the N770. 
> 
> Is there an easy way to make an application always run as "root" ?

Currently no. However, (AFAIK) the 2006 OS release will allow you to 
install packages with root privileges.

> Is there an alternative for applications to access functions within 
> the SDP without running as root.

Are you talking about server or client side SDP functionality? Enabling 
sdpd on the current SW releases requires root, but creating new local 
service records or performing client side operations should be possible
without root. (btw, the 2006 OS release will have sdpd running by 
default so that problem will be solved there).
